Sixers Draft Ben Simmons With No. 1 Pick

Ben Simmons verticalAs expected, the Sixers opened this year’s draft by taking LSU’s Ben Simmons. The 6’10” Australian native, who has been the consensus No. 1 choice since the beginning of the college season, averaged 19.2 points, 11.8 rebounds and 4.8 assists during his lone season with the Tigers.

After landing the top pick in last month’s lottery, Philadelphia was reportedly deciding between Simmons and Duke forward Brandon Ingram. On Tuesday, the Sixers informed Simmons that he would be their choice.

Simmons is the latest in a string of big men drafted early by the Sixers. He joins a crowded frontcourt that includes Jahlil Okafor, Nerlens Noel, Joel Embiid and maybe Croatian star Dario Saric. Philadelphia is reportedly trying to package Noel and its selections at Nos. 24 and 26 to obtain a top-eight pick.
